-
【首发】编程中的代码审查:确保代码质量的关键环节
所属栏目:[资讯] 日期:2024-12-21 热度:5687
在软件开发过程中,代码审查是一项至关重要的活动。它不仅是确保代码质量的关键环节,更是提升团队协作效率、降低错误率以及保障软件安全性的重要手段。通过代码审查,我们可以对编写的代码进行全面的评估,从而[详细]
-
【首发】编程中的测试驱动开发:提升代码质量的有效方法
所属栏目:[资讯] 日期:2024-12-21 热度:709
在编程领域,测试驱动开发(Test-Driven Development,简称TDD)已经成为一种广泛接受的开发方法。这种方法强调在编写实际代码之前先编写测试代码,以确保代码的质量和正确性。通过TDD,开发人员可以在开发过程中及[详细]
-
【首发】编程中的重构技巧:如何优雅地改进现有代码?
所属栏目:[资讯] 日期:2024-12-21 热度:4274
在编程过程中,重构是一项至关重要的技能。随着项目的不断发展,代码库可能会变得庞大而复杂,这时候就需要我们运用重构技巧来优化代码,提高可维护性和可读性。那么,如何优雅地改进现有代码呢?下面我将分享一些[详细]
-
【首发】编程中的设计模式:从原理到实战的全方位解析
所属栏目:[资讯] 日期:2024-12-21 热度:125
在编程的世界里,设计模式是一种被反复使用、经过时间考验的解决方案,用于解决特定上下文中的常见问题。它们是对软件设计中常见问题的最佳实践总结,使得代码更加可维护、可扩展、可重用。设计模式的重要性不言[详细]
-
【首发】数据库编程实战:关系型数据库与非关系型数据库的比较与选择
所属栏目:[资讯] 日期:2024-12-21 热度:6785
在数据库编程的实战中,选择正确的数据库类型至关重要。本文将对关系型数据库(RDBMS)和非关系型数据库(NoSQL)进行比较,帮助读者理解它们各自的特点和适用场景,从而做出明智的选择。 首先,我们来回顾一下关[详细]
-
【首发】编程中的性能监控:如何找出并优化代码中的瓶颈?
所属栏目:[资讯] 日期:2024-12-21 热度:6808
在编程中,性能监控是一项至关重要的任务。随着应用程序变得越来越复杂,代码中的瓶颈问题也变得越来越难以察觉。然而,找出并优化这些瓶颈对于提高应用程序的性能和用户体验至关重要。下面我们将探讨一些有效的[详细]
-
【首发】编程中的并发控制:确保数据一致性的关键
所属栏目:[资讯] 日期:2024-12-21 热度:4778
在编程中,并发控制是一个至关重要的概念,它涉及到如何管理多个同时发生的操作,以确保数据的一致性和完整性。随着现代计算机系统的复杂性和多用户交互性的增加,并发控制变得越来越重要。本文将探讨并发控制的[详细]
-
【首发】嵌入式系统编程:硬件与软件的完美融合
所属栏目:[资讯] 日期:2024-12-21 热度:2249
嵌入式系统编程,无疑是现代科技领域中的一项重要技术。这种编程方式将硬件与软件巧妙地结合在一起,实现了技术与应用的完美结合。在嵌入式系统编程中,硬件与软件不再是孤立的存在,而是相互依存、相互促进的关[详细]
-
【首发】编程中的内存管理:如何避免内存泄漏与提升性能?
所属栏目:[资讯] 日期:2024-12-21 热度:1055
编程中的内存管理是一个至关重要的环节,它直接关系到程序的稳定性和性能。在编程过程中,内存泄漏是一个常见的问题,它会导致程序占用的内存逐渐增多,最终可能导致程序崩溃或系统资源耗尽。因此,了解如何避免[详细]
-
【首发】网络安全编程:防御DDoS攻击的策略与技巧
所属栏目:[资讯] 日期:2024-12-21 热度:7694
在当前的数字化世界中,网络安全已经成为了一项至关重要的任务。DDoS(分布式拒绝服务)攻击是一种常见的网络攻击方式,它通过向目标服务器发送大量请求,使其无法处理正常用户的请求,从而导致服务中断。因此,防[详细]
-
【首发】编程中的异步编程:提升程序性能的关键技术
所属栏目:[资讯] 日期:2024-12-21 热度:9883
在编程领域,异步编程是一种重要的技术,它允许程序在执行某些任务时,不会阻塞主线程的执行,从而极大地提升了程序的性能。这种技术尤其适用于那些需要长时间运行的任务,例如网络请求、文件读写、数据库操作等[详细]
-
【首发】游戏引擎编程:从原理到实现的全过程
所属栏目:[资讯] 日期:2024-12-21 热度:8935
在当今的数字娱乐时代,游戏已经成为了人们生活中不可或缺的一部分。而背后的游戏引擎,作为游戏的“心脏”,承载着整个游戏世界的构建和运行。那么,游戏引擎编程到底是什么样的呢?本文将从原理到实现[详细]
-
【首发】大数据编程基础:处理海量数据的必备技能
所属栏目:[资讯] 日期:2024-12-21 热度:3772
在数字化时代,大数据已经成为了各个行业不可或缺的一部分。无论是金融、医疗、教育还是其他领域,都需要处理和分析大量的数据来提取有价值的信息。因此,掌握大数据编程基础成为了现代职场人必备的技能之一。 [详细]
-
【首发】编程语言新动态:Rust的崛起与影响
所属栏目:[资讯] 日期:2024-12-21 热度:5373
随着技术的飞速发展,编程语言的世界也在不断地发生变革。近年来,Rust语言以其独特的魅力和强大的功能,逐渐崭露头角,成为了编程界的一股新势力。Rust的崛起不仅改变了编程语言的格局,还对整个技术生态产生了[详细]
-
【首发】人工智能编程:机器学习与深度学习的原理与实践
所属栏目:[资讯] 日期:2024-12-21 热度:9537
在当今这个信息爆炸的时代,人工智能技术已经深入到我们生活的方方面面,从智能语音助手到自动驾驶汽车,再到医疗和金融等多个领域,人工智能都扮演着重要的角色。而在这背后,机器学习和深度学习作为其核心技术[详细]
-
【首发】编程中的设计模式:提升代码可维护性的利器
所属栏目:[资讯] 日期:2024-12-21 热度:1390
随着软件开发的复杂性和规模不断增长,如何确保代码的可维护性成为了一项重要的挑战。设计模式作为一种经过验证的编程经验和最佳实践,为我们提供了一种解决这一问题的有效方法。 设计模式是一种通用的解决方[详细]
-
【首发】数据结构与算法:编程中的基石与灵魂
所属栏目:[资讯] 日期:2024-12-21 热度:3676
在编程的世界里,数据结构与算法就如同建筑中的基石和灵魂,它们共同构建了程序世界的巍峨大厦。没有它们,编程将变得苍白无力,如同失去了灵魂的躯壳。 数据结构是程序设计中用于组织、存储和管理数据的方式[详细]
-
【首发】移动应用编程趋势:跨平台与原生开发的融合
所属栏目:[资讯] 日期:2024-12-21 热度:7058
随着移动应用的普及和用户需求的多样化,移动应用编程趋势正朝着跨平台与原生开发的融合方向发展。这种融合不仅提高了开发效率,也优化了用户体验,为移动应用开发带来了新的机遇和挑战。 跨平台开发是指使用[详细]
-
【首发】云计算编程基础:从虚拟机到容器化技术的演进
所属栏目:[资讯] 日期:2024-12-21 热度:4234
随着云计算技术的快速发展,编程基础也在不断演进。从最初的虚拟机技术,到现在的容器化技术,云计算编程基础经历了巨大的变革。本文将探讨这一演进过程,帮助读者更好地理解云计算编程基础的发展历程。 一、[详细]
-
【首发】编程中的错误处理与调试技巧
所属栏目:[资讯] 日期:2024-12-21 热度:2260
编程中的错误处理与调试技巧对于程序员来说至关重要。一个成功的程序员不仅要能够编写出高效、稳定的代码,更要能够熟练地处理错误和调试代码。下面,我们将深入探讨编程中的错误处理与调试技巧。 首先,我们[详细]
-
【首发】编程中的性能调优:如何找出并优化代码中的瓶颈?
所属栏目:[资讯] 日期:2024-12-21 热度:6736
在编程中,性能调优是一项至关重要的任务。优化代码中的瓶颈可以显著提高程序的执行效率,从而提升用户体验和系统性能。然而,找出并优化代码中的瓶颈并非易事,需要开发者具备扎实的编程基础和丰富的经验。 [详细]
-
【首发】自动化测试在编程中的应用:提升质量与效率的关键
所属栏目:[资讯] 日期:2024-12-21 热度:6736
自动化测试在编程中的应用已经成为现代软件开发流程中不可或缺的一部分。随着技术的不断发展和进步,软件的质量和效率成为了决定一个项目成功与否的关键因素。而自动化测试,作为一种高效、准确的测试方法,正在[详细]
-
【首发】机器学习编程实战:用Python实现图像识别与分类
所属栏目:[资讯] 日期:2024-12-21 热度:8102
随着人工智能技术的不断发展,图像识别与分类已经成为了许多领域的必备技能。而Python作为一种易于上手、功能强大的编程语言,也成为了实现图像识别与分类的首选工具。 在本文中,我们将使用Python的机器学习[详细]
-
【首发】区块链编程入门:构建去中心化应用的基石
所属栏目:[资讯] 日期:2024-12-21 热度:1525
随着数字技术的飞速发展,区块链技术已经逐渐从幕后走到了台前,成为了一个备受瞩目的领域。作为去中心化应用的基石,区块链技术为各行各业带来了前所未有的可能性。那么,如何入门区块链编程,构建属于自己的去[详细]
-
【首发】物联网编程基础:从设备到云的通信原理
所属栏目:[资讯] 日期:2024-12-21 热度:5916
物联网(IoT)编程基础是一个涉及多个领域的复杂话题,其中包括硬件、软件、网络通信和数据分析等多个方面。在物联网中,设备之间的通信至关重要,它们需要将数据从设备传输到云端,以便进行进一步的分析和处理。 [详细]